87 SEZ projects notified: Kamalnath
Chhindwara, MP, May 27 (UNI) Union Commerce and Industry Minister Kamalnath today said that 87 Special Economic Zone (SEZ) projects had been notified in the country.
''The projects will attract investment to the tune of Rs 60,000 crore. Two of the projects have been ayed for this area. I am strictly against compulsory land acquisition for SEZs. Thousands of free acres, at Nagpur, of the Maharashtra State Industrial Development Corporation have been given for SEZs,'' the local MP told mediapersons here.
The Minister announced that an institution linked to footwear designing and another related to contruction training would soon be set up here.
He laid the foundation stone of a National Institute of Information Technology-aided District Learning Centre at this district's Badkui for imparting employment-oriented training to youth. One such centre is functioning here for the past year.
